About Landmark 81

Located in Vinhomes Central Park, Binh Thanh District, Landmark 81 stands 461.3 meters tall with 81 floors, making it the tallest building in Vietnam. Developed by Vingroup, the tower features Vincom Center Landmark 81, luxury residences, offices, a five-star hotel, restaurants, cafés and the popular Landmark 81 SkyView observation deck.

Inspired by the shape of a traditional bamboo bundle, Landmark 81 has become one of Ho Chi Minh City’s most popular attractions, welcoming visitors with spectacular skyline views, shopping, dining and entertainment in one destination.

Where Is Landmark 81 Located?

Landmark 81 is located in Vinhomes Central Park, Binh Thanh District, Ho Chi Minh City, just a few kilometers from District 1. Although many visitors think it’s in the city center, the tower actually stands across the Saigon River and is only about 10–15 minutes by taxi or Grab from popular attractions like Ben Thanh Market and Nguyen Hue Walking Street.

You can also reach Landmark 81 by Saigon Waterbus, then enjoy a short walk through Vinhomes Central Park before arriving at the tower. Its convenient location makes it easy to combine with other sightseeing spots during your trip. How to Get to Landmark 81

By Taxi or Grab

Taking a taxi or Grab is the fastest and most convenient way to reach Landmark 81. From District 1, the journey usually takes 10–15 minutes, depending on traffic. This is the best option for families, groups and first-time visitors to Ho Chi Minh City.

By Bus

Several public bus routes stop near Landmark 81, making public transport an affordable choice. Popular routes include 06, 30, 32, 47, 56, 69, 86, 104, 124 and 150. From the nearest bus stop, it’s only a short walk to the tower.

By Saigon Waterbus

For a more scenic journey, take the Saigon Waterbus from Bach Dang Station in District 1 to Binh An Station. From there, you can enjoy a pleasant walk through Vinhomes Central Park or take a short taxi ride to Landmark 81. It’s a relaxing way to admire the Saigon River while avoiding city traffic.

Tips for Visiting Landmark 81

  • Visit before sunset to enjoy both daytime views and the city lights after dark.
  • Book SkyView tickets in advance during weekends and public holidays to avoid long queues.
  • Wear comfortable shoes if you plan to explore Vinhomes Central Park after visiting the tower.
  • Bring a camera or smartphone to capture panoramic views of Ho Chi Minh City from the observation deck.
  • Allow at least 2–3 hours to explore SkyView, shopping, dining and Vinhomes Central Park at a relaxed pace.

Landmark 81, a symbol of modern Vietnamese architecture

Landmark 81 is a skyscraper located within the Vinhomes Central Park complex, with a total investment of 40 trillion VND from Vingroup. The 81-story tower is currently the tallest building in Vietnam and the 14th tallest in the world, construction of which began in March 2018. The project is located in Tan Cang, Binh Thanh District, along the Saigon River, and construction commenced on July 26, 2014. As part of the massive Vinhomes Landmark apartment complex, this skyscraper is easily recognizable from most street corners in the city and even from other provinces and cities.

The 461.3-meter-tall tower serves multiple purposes including a shopping mall, cinema, gym, club, bar, penthouse villas, 5-star apartments, 5-star hotel, observation deck, and more. Upon completion, the building received the title of “Tallest Building in Southeast Asia” and became a promising investment and residential location in Ho Chi Minh City.
